Ok, Im at home now and have had a look at the bars, they do look nice and substantial but unlike the TTE ones in the instructions above there are only two positions on the front bar for adjustment so my initial plan of going for the middle position is somewhat flawed, so the question to anyone who has them fitted is which position should I use the instructions mention 179% and 260% but are all in the foreign so is this the % above stock.

ChrisGB

#52
Quote from: "E"Ok, I'm at home now and have had a look at the bars, they do look nice and substantial but unlike the TTE ones in the instructions above there are only two positions on the front bar for adjustment so my initial plan of going for the middle position is somewhat flawed, so the question to anyone who has them fitted is which position should I use the instructions mention 179% and 260% but are all in the foreign so is this the % above stock.

Stiffer front = less front grip, so start there, see if it under steers, if it does you can stiffen the rear to counter the understeer or soften the front.  Start safe, work the balance to taste from there.
